Does the importer of record have to own the goods?

does the ior have to own the goods

No, the Importer of Record (IOR) does not have to own the goods. Ownership and legal responsibility for import compliance are two separate things. Is Importer of Record the buyer?

Is IOR the buyer?

The Importer of Record (IOR) is not always the buyer of the goods. While the buyer can act as the IOR, especially in standard B2B transactions, it ultimately depends on the shipping arrangement and who takes responsibility for customs compliance. Do I need an Importer Of Record?

do i need an ior

Whether or not you need an Importer of Record (IOR) depends on where you’re shipping and your legal presence in that country. If your business lacks a local entity, import license, or compliance infrastructure in the destination country, then yes, you need an IOR.
